# Load test harness for the Vantrel checkout flow.
# Targets the staging gateway only; production endpoints are blocked
# at the proxy layer. Simulates 500 concurrent carts through the
# Quillmart payment stub, no real card data involved. Rate limits
# are lifted for the loadgen role, so do not reuse this client
# elsewhere. All traffic is tagged for audit replay.
# The client authenticates against the internal Ledgerline service
# using the key below.

API key for kahag-tagef: kto2_sw

Ticket: Crashfall ingest failing on staging

New folks, please read carefully. The Pebblekit mobile app's crash reports aren't reaching the symbolication queue because staging's env file was copied without its upload credential. Symptoms: 401s in the collector logs every five minutes. To fix, add the missing line to the env file, exactly as follows.

secret setting of fafop-tagep: VAULT_KEY29=6a815d21e2d77cc25ef1802d73ee6

**Mgmt Meeting Minutes — Retiring the Brightline Range**

Quick recap for sales leads at Fenholt Supplies: we agreed to retire the Brightline fixture range by year-end. Remaining stock moves to clearance pricing next month, and accounts on standing orders get migrated to the Lumetta range. Trade-in incentives were approved in principle. The confidential note on next steps sits just below.

board note of bajof-bajeg: The pricing group signed off on a budget of $13.4 million for Project Sildor. The renewal with Lamixek Holdings closes at $48.9 million a year, 49 percent above the last contract.

Finance Review Summary — Q3 Cash-Flow Forecast, Arandel Instruments

Heads of department: the Q3 forecast shows inflows tightening in weeks five through eight, driven by slower remittances from the Veldmark distributors and the Oristay tooling spend. Payables have been re-phased and the contingency buffer holds at six weeks. Please review your departmental commitments carefully before Thursday. The confidential note on our planning assumptions appears directly below.

confidential, kagep-kahof: Druokax Systems plans to lower the Ulaath list price by 53 percent in March.